The final trailer for The Legend of Zelda: Tears of the Kingdom (TotK) is finally out! And the hype is absolutely unreal. And remember to pay special attention to 0:40, because that is when the main theme of Twilight Princess comes into play! It’s definitely an intriguing moment, as we all know earlier that in the game’s leaked art book, there is indeed a costume resembling Zant’s armor.

So many things have happened in such a short period of time! Ganondorf has been fully revived. Below is his official promotional art.

(Source: Nintendo)

And as seen in the three-minute video, we will get a chance to reunite with our beloved allies from Breath of the Wild, like Sidon, Riju, and is that… Teba’s son, Tulin? Does this mean there will be a companion system in TotK? Where is Yunobo? And why is Sidon wearing the crown of King Dorephan?

Breaking news is incoming! The final trailer for The Legend of Zelda: Tears of the Kingdom, is revealed to be coming tomorrow, April 13. The last three minutes of brand-new gameplay will be unveiled at 7:00 AM (PT). Thus, leaving the community on the edge of their seats, bursting with uncontainable excitement.

This will be the last pre-launch trailer for the game. TotK has been in development for several years. Despite the art book leak, Nintendo has sealed its lips about the game’s details. As a result, every bit of information released becomes a treasure trove of content and speculation for fans. A prime example is the 10-minute gameplay clip featuring Eiji Aonuma. It offered Zelda lovers a glimpse of new gameplay mechanics as well as Link’s new arsenal. And only in those very few minutes, fans were able to come up with countless fascinating theories. One of which is the possibility of underwater adventures.
